    The Hotel des Artistes is one of the best hotels I've ever stayed in not only in France but elsewhere in Europe. The room we had was large (in France!) and elegantly decorated. The beds were comfortable, obviously of high quality, as well as the fixtures in the bathroom-- the shower in the bathroom spanned the whole wall. I couldn't believe that such an elegant and spacious room (including a walk-in area within the room with a small refrigerator and electric teapot) would be available at such a reasonable price. The location is also perfect: right near everything on the peninsula, next to the Saône where the Sunday Marché St. Antoine is, and a bridge away from the Vieux Lyon. An excellent value and major find for future visits to Lyon.

    I stayed here for two nights during the light festival in December. The hotel's location is amazing - very central but a bit hidden away next to a theater. It was great to be able to open the window. The room was spotlessly clean. That's probably the most important thing I look for. The hotel itself too. Housekeeping between the two nights was done well. The beds were comfortable (not too soft/not too hard), with good quality bedding. The bathroom had 2 sinks and a shower with good pressure. I liked that the toilet was in a separate room. It was quiet. We had a mini-fridge. The two very small comments: it would have been nice to have a set up for tea/coffee in the room and EUR 17 per person seems too high for breakfast (or at least maybe there could be a lower price option for people like me who eat a small breakfast). Overall, we had a nice time and I would not hesitate to recommend the hotel without reservation.
